源文件是什么呢?以下是PINCAI小編整理的關(guān)于源文件的相關(guān)內(nèi)容,歡迎閱讀和參考!
源文件是什么_源文件的簡(jiǎn)介
源文件是什么
源文件一般指用匯編語(yǔ)言或高級(jí)語(yǔ)言寫出來(lái)的代碼保存為文件后的結(jié)果。
源文件的簡(jiǎn)介
1.理論上的概念
源文件是相對(duì)目標(biāo)文件和可執(zhí)行文件而言的。
源文件就是用匯編語(yǔ)言或高級(jí)語(yǔ)言寫出來(lái)的代碼保存為文件后的結(jié)果。
目標(biāo)文件是指源文件經(jīng)過(guò)編譯程序產(chǎn)生的能被cpu直接識(shí)別二進(jìn)制文件。
可執(zhí)行文件就是將目標(biāo)文件連接后形成的可執(zhí)行文件,當(dāng)然也是二進(jìn)制的。
2.最直觀的概念
在這個(gè)網(wǎng)頁(yè)上右鍵鼠標(biāo),選擇查看源文件.出來(lái)一個(gè)記事本,里面的內(nèi)容就是此網(wǎng)頁(yè)的源代碼.
關(guān)于兩者的區(qū)別聯(lián)系:
1.從字面意義上來(lái)講,源文件是指一個(gè)文件,指源代碼的集合.源代碼則是一組具有特定意義的可以實(shí)現(xiàn)特定功能的字符(程序開發(fā)代碼).
2."源代碼"在大多數(shù)時(shí)候等于"源文件".
上面說(shuō)過(guò)"2.最直觀的概念在這個(gè)網(wǎng)頁(yè)上右鍵鼠標(biāo),選擇查看源文件.出來(lái)一個(gè)記事本,里面的內(nèi)容就是此網(wǎng)頁(yè)的源代碼."這句話就體現(xiàn)了他們的關(guān)系,此處的源文件是指網(wǎng)頁(yè)的源文件,而源代碼就是源文件的內(nèi)容,所以又可以稱做網(wǎng)頁(yè)的源代碼..
其他語(yǔ)言也是一樣的,如C語(yǔ)言,相應(yīng)的就稱為C語(yǔ)言源文件,在不混淆的情況下也稱為源文件.
拓展閱讀:源文件其他知識(shí)
常規(guī)解決辦法
1.注銷或重啟電腦,然后再試著刪除。
2.進(jìn)入“安全模式刪除”。
3.在純DOS命令行下使用DEL,DELTREE和RD命令將其刪除。
4.如果是文件夾中有比較多的子目錄或文件而導(dǎo)致無(wú)法刪除,可先刪除該文件夾中的子目錄和文件,再刪除文件夾。
5.在任務(wù)管理器中結(jié)束Explorer.exe進(jìn)程,然后在命令提示符窗口刪除文件。
6.如果你有安裝ACDSee,F(xiàn)lashFXP,Nero,Total這幾個(gè)軟件,可以嘗試在這幾個(gè)軟件中刪除文件夾。
高級(jí)解決方案
1.磁盤錯(cuò)誤
運(yùn)行磁盤掃描,并掃描文件所在分區(qū),掃描前確定已選上修復(fù)文件和壞扇區(qū),全面掃描所有選項(xiàng),掃描后再刪除文件。
2.預(yù)讀機(jī)制:
某些媒體播放中斷或正在預(yù)覽時(shí)會(huì)造成無(wú)法刪除。在“運(yùn)行”框中輸入:REGSVR32 /U SHMEDIA.DLL,注銷掉預(yù)讀功能;騽h除注冊(cè)表中下面這個(gè)鍵值:[HKEY_LOCAL_MACHINESOFTWAREClassesCLSID{87D62D94-71B3-4b9a-9489-5FE6850DC73E}InProcServer32]。
3.防火墻:
由于反病毒軟件在查毒時(shí)會(huì)占用正在檢查的文件,從而導(dǎo)致執(zhí)行刪除時(shí)提示文件正在使用,這時(shí)可試著暫時(shí)關(guān)閉它的即時(shí)監(jiān)控程序,或許可以解決。
4.OFFice、WPS系列軟件:
OFFice的非法關(guān)閉也會(huì)造成文件無(wú)法刪除或改名。重新運(yùn)行該程序,然后正常關(guān)閉,再刪除文件。
5.借助WinRAR:
右擊要?jiǎng)h除的文件夾,選擇“添加到壓縮文件”。在彈出的對(duì)話框中選中“壓縮后刪除源文件,”隨便寫個(gè)壓縮包名,點(diǎn)確定。
6.權(quán)限問題:
如果是2000,xp,win7和win8系統(tǒng),請(qǐng)先確定是否有權(quán)限刪除這個(gè)文件或文件夾。
7.可執(zhí)行文件的刪除:
如果可執(zhí)行文件的映像或程序所調(diào)用的DLL動(dòng)態(tài)鏈接庫(kù)文件還在內(nèi)存中未釋放,刪除時(shí)就會(huì)提示文件正在使用,解決方法是刪除系統(tǒng)的頁(yè)面文件,Win98中是Win386.SWP,Win2000/XP是pagefile.sys。注意要在DOS下刪除。
8.文件粉碎法:
使用文件粉碎機(jī),如File Pulverizer,可以徹底刪除一些頑固
[源文件是什么_源文件的簡(jiǎn)介]